我正试图在Windows 7主机上的Oracle VM中安装Arch (本周下载和安装)上的vim (7.4)环绕式扩展。
当我的光标放在引号中时,我会收到各种各样的错误,包括E388 (无法找到定义):
:ds"
和E257 (cstag:标记未找到)在<div>Hello World</div>
上,当我的光标在标记中时,我尝试如下:
:cst<p>
我从git下载了最新版本的vim环绕声。
我有:设置nocp
我把surround.vim放进了~/.vim/plugin
我重新启动了vim
我已经重新生成了帮助标记,:help surround
也可以工作。
当用户运行vim时,我提取了文件,没有权限错误。
运行:scriptnames
会在列表中显示~/.vim/plugin/surround
。
因此,据我所知,它已经安装,只是它没有工作。有什么想法吗?
发布于 2014-08-30 10:40:45
环绕声几乎肯定是正确的,你只是不知道如何使用它和/或不理解"Ex“命令和普通模式命令之间的区别。
:ds
是:dsplit
的简称,参见:help :dsplit
。:cst
是:cstag
的简称,参见:help :cstag
。它们是"Ex“命令,但ds
和cst
不是"Ex”命令:它们是普通模式命令。
而不是做:
:ds"
:cst<p>
做:
ds"
cst<p>
和…阅读奇妙的手册::help surround
。
https://stackoverflow.com/questions/25580760
复制相似问题